When parents and students are choosing a new school, they're as likely to go to your Facebook or Twitter page as they are to your website.
BUT... unlike your website, they can talk to other parents and students and find out what you're really like - or at least the picture painted by others.
If your establishment doesn't have a social media presence, it doesn't have a voice.
